Preview: Knightdale Knights vs. Sanderson Spartans

Knightdale and Sanderson are an even 5-5 against one another since November of 2016, but not for long. The Knightdale Knights will be staying on the road on Tuesday to face off against the Sanderson Spartans at 6:30 p.m. on December 19th. Knightdale will be strutting in after a victory while Sanderson will be coming in after a defeat.

Even though East Wake scored an imposing 57 points on Friday, Knightdale still came out on top. Knightdale enjoyed a cozy 71-57 win over East Wake. Given Knightdale's advantage in MaxPreps' North Carolina basketball rankings (they are ranked 109th, while East Wake is ranked 359th), the result wasn't entirely unexpected.

Knightdale's win was a true team effort, with many players turning in solid performances. Perhaps the best among them was Brandon Adams, who dropped a double-double on 14 points and 11 rebounds. Those 14 points set a new season-high mark for him. Khaim Taylor was another key contributor, scoring 12 points along with six rebounds.

Meanwhile, Sanderson pushed their score all the way to 63 last Friday, but even that wasn't enough to win. They were just a bucket shy of victory and fell 64-63 to Heritage. Sanderson's loss continues a unfortunate trend for the team, making it three in a row.

Nathan Fife put forth a good effort for the losing side as he scored 23 points along with five steals. The match was his fourth in a row with at least ten points. The team also got some help courtesy of Kendrick Pulley, who scored ten points.

Knightdale is on a roll lately: they've won five of their last six games, which provided a nice bump to their 8-2 record this season. As for Sanderson, their defeat dropped their record down to 3-3.
